Xie Yuping had made it clear that Xie Jinghu was not to go to Rongcheng and disturb Zou Weijun and Xie Qian’s lives, a fact well-known to Xie Jinghu’s trusted assistant.

This was mainly for Zou Weijun’s health, to avoid Xie Jinghu upsetting her.

In a split second, Xie Jinghu devised a plan—he simply wouldn’t meet Zou Weijun, or he’d just catch a glimpse of her without letting her see him!

Xie Jinghu knew his eldest brother, Xie Yuping, would agree to this. After all, Xie Yuping didn’t want him to divorce Zou Weijun. With someone openly pursuing Zou Weijun in Rongcheng, his showing up was a way to protect the family’s integrity!

He could even use this to remind Xie Yuping and their mother: a long-distance marriage, even without issues, could develop problems, especially in his and Zou Weijun’s situation.

Xie Jinghu didn’t need to act. When he faced Xie Yuping, he was genuinely furious, the picture of a pitiful man on the verge of being cuckolded.

Startled, Old Madam Xie leaned forward instinctively, then slowly sat back, saying, “Weijun isn’t that kind of person.”

Zou Weijun had been married into the Xie family for nearly twenty years, devoted entirely to Xie Jinghu. If Old Madam Xie couldn’t see that, she’d truly be a senile old fool!

Moreover, Old Madam Xie approved of Zou Weijun’s upbringing.

If Zou Weijun no longer wanted to be with Xie Jinghu, she’d propose divorce first, not cheat during the marriage.

The Zou family’s upbringing was just that impeccable.

At this thought, Old Madam Xie glared fiercely at Xie Jinghu.

If not for her third son’s shameful behaviour, the Xie family’s upbringing would be no less than the Zou family’s!

“I didn’t say she’s that kind of person,” Xie Jinghu explained awkwardly. “But if I don’t go, won’t others laugh at me, at the Xie family?”

Xie Jinghu swore he’d only deal with Zou Weijun’s “suitor” and not disturb her. Old Madam Xie was half-convinced.

“Big Brother—”

Xie Yuping, who hadn’t spoken on the matter, left Xie Jinghu anxious, prompting him to urge Xie Yuping.

Xie Yuping considered it and, unlike Old Madam Xie, wasn’t entirely opposed.

“Third Brother, do you think I should trust you?”

Before Xie Jinghu could swear again, Xie Yuping answered himself, “If you betray my trust, I have no other way but to feel sorry for Weijun and her son. I’ll have to find a way to make it up to them. There’s a stack of unsigned documents in my study. Be cautious in your actions.”

If Xie Jinghu couldn’t resist disturbing Zou Weijun or had ill intentions, the stack of fully prepared “share transfer agreements” in Xie Yuping’s study, awaiting only a signature, would be a sobering remedy!

Xie Jinghu: “…!”

Old Madam Xie stayed silent.

Jinhu Group would eventually belong to Xie Qian. Transferring more to him now was fitting, keeping those foreign women at bay.

Already angry about someone targeting his wife, Xie Jinghu was further irritated by his brother.

Xie Yuping clearly distrusted him, even assigning someone to accompany him to Rongcheng.

This was outright surveillance!

Just like placing people in Jinhu to monitor him comprehensively.

Xie Jinghu was very displeased. Xie Yuping said calmly, “Don’t overthink it. I’m just worried you’ll act impulsively. Civilised people don’t resort to violence. It’s for your own good.”

Old Madam Xie fully agreed with her eldest son.

“Your brother’s right. When you were young, you got into plenty of fights outside, and every time, your brother cleaned up your mess. Only he cares this much and thinks so thoroughly!”

—So should I kneel and thank Big Brother?

Xie Jinghu reluctantly agreed.

Eager, he had his assistant book the earliest flight to Rongcheng the next day.

After he left in a hurry, Old Madam Xie sighed, “Xie Qian’s already a teenager, and Third Brother still hasn’t grown up.”

Xie Yuping thought for a moment, comforting his mother, “It’s not necessarily all bad. He’s always seen Weijun as his possession. Long marriages can lose passion. Now, separated for a while, unable to see Weijun and hearing someone’s pursuing her, he might realise she could be courted by others if he loses her. It could give him a new perspective on their marriage.”

A man being cuckolded is a grave humiliation, so Xie Jinghu was furious.

But conversely, a man’s infidelity is equally humiliating and hurtful to a woman!

Do not do to others what you don’t want done to you.

If Xie Jinghu could learn to see things from Zou Weijun’s perspective, their marriage might still have a chance… Xie Yuping thought of the mother and three children abroad, feeling irritated.

If only there were no children.

Children create unbreakable ties.

Xie Jinghu’s attachment to the mother and three children abroad was largely due to the kids, and that woman was indeed cunning. As the saying goes, a wife is less exciting than a mistress, and a mistress less than an affair. The secrecy kept Xie Jinghu intrigued.

If that woman hadn’t gone abroad and had agreed to Xie Jinghu’s request to stay and marry him, after all these years, the passion of youth would have faded in marriage.

What sustains a marriage isn’t passion, but responsibility.

Compared to Zou Weijun in a long-distance dynamic, that woman was no match!

Though Xie Yuping sent Zhong Yong to accompany Xie Jinghu, he was still uneasy and called Xie Qian.

“Uncle, it’s just a small matter.”

Xie Qian had once seen it as a big deal, but with Zou Weijun handling it so well, he didn’t care anymore.

Xie Qian was thrilled to share Zou Weijun’s improving health with Xie Yuping, easing some of Xie Yuping’s burden, “That’s good, that’s good!”

People are selfish, and Xie Yuping was no saint. He was thinking of the Xie family too.

Wronging Zou Weijun had always weighed on him.

The Xie family owed her, and financial compensation was due. Her depression improving truly gladdened Xie Yuping.

“Your dad’s going to Rongcheng.”

Xie Yuping briefly explained his thoughts to Xie Qian. Since Xie Qian was still young, he kept it simple, saying letting Xie Jinghu see Zou Weijun’s current state might not be bad.

“Of course, your dad promised me he’d only look from afar, not disturb your mom. I’m sending Zhong Yong with him to ensure he doesn’t mess up.”

Xie Qian thought, what’s there to see?

Seeing his mom doing well now, rediscovering her charm, could that erase what happened?

Xie Qian didn’t argue with his uncle. He was clear-headed, and no one could sway his resolve.

“Uncle, I understand.”

Let him come.

If not this time, his dad would find another excuse to come to Rongcheng later.

Wen Ying heard Xie Jinghu was coming to Rongcheng and was curious, so excited she texted Xie Qian from under her covers at midnight.

“What does your dad look like?”

A real-life scumbag, Wen Ying wanted to see!

Xie Qian didn’t care, casually replying to Wen Ying:

“Just looks like that, one mouth, two eyes, nothing special.”

—No matter how good-looking, a bad character makes you ugly!
